# Tideline Widget — Environments

The tide-table widget runs in three environments: dev, staging, prod. Dev uses synthetic tide data; staging pulls the Harbourfell feed hourly; prod polls every ten minutes with failover to the cached table. If prod alerts fire, check feed staleness first — the widget silently serves cache up to six hours old. Staging credentials rotate weekly. The prod environment currently runs with the following configuration.

deployment values, yadug-bawif:
[framir]
team = pelox
access_code = ac_a38ab2
owner = tamion.julael
host = framir.tolvaqlabs.test
port = 11211
peer = tammir.zemvargrid.local
salt = 2215ef03
pin = 1541

**Key Ceremony Checklist — Item 7 (TilePorter Prefetcher)**

Before sealing the signing key for the TilePorter map-tile prefetcher, the support representative must verify both witnesses have signed the ceremony log and the hardware token is registered. Then confirm you can unlock the escrow container unaided, since support handles after-hours recovery. The container prompt accepts the recovery passphrase written directly below.

strongbox words: norwyn-wenael-aldvan-aldiel-wendor-holael

/*
 * Client setup for the Tollgate rules engine, which evaluates shipping-fee
 * policies for all Bramblewick storefronts. Rules are fetched at startup and
 * cached for five minutes; evaluation itself happens locally, so only rule
 * syncs hit the network. Note that the engine distinguishes zone surcharges
 * from carrier surcharges — reviewers should confirm both paths are covered
 * by the fixtures in tests/fees. The client authenticates against the
 * internal Tollgate endpoint using the service key that follows.
 */

gateway credential: kto3_qfe

Subject: DR drill Thursday — formula sandbox

Reviewing the Quillbrook formula sandbox before the drill. User-supplied formulas must stay in the Vexel interpreter jail; no escape hatches in the eval path. During the drill we wipe the sandbox vault and restore from cold backup. Flag anything that bypasses the jail. The restore step requires the recovery passphrase below.

vault phrase of tajef-tafog = istox-sorax-zorox-casok-holox-kelix-weneth-drueth-casion